Can you explain when is the O-lineman is holding and when he isn't?
@Steelers_DB5 ай бұрын
they make it complex but ill try to keep it simple: It's really about keeping the defender within the cylinder of your body and keeping your body between the defender and ball carrier. It's a little bit of a subjective call which causes a bunch of confusion. Here is what is stated on the official NFL rulebook: Use his hands or arms to materially restrict an opponent or alter the defender’s path or angle of pursuit. It is a foul regardless of whether the blocker’s hands are inside or outside the frame of the defender’s body. Material restrictions include but are not limited to: grabbing or tackling an opponent; hooking, jerking, twisting, or turning him; or pulling him to the ground.
